    The SBB use to offer a Half Card for one month. I can not longer find that option on the SBB site. It now looks like you can only purchase a half card for one year. Is this a recent change or am I looking in the wrong place to purchase a one month half card?

    Hi dg234,

    The Swiss Half Fare Card is valid for one month and is geared for travellers. On the other hand, the Half Fare Travelcard is geared for local commuters/ residents.
